It originally launched in 2015 in Colorado and Montana in 4 flavors. Recently it expanded to 6 flavors and is pushing into more states in the US. This year you will be able to find it in California, Nevada, Arizona, New Mexico, Colorado, Utah, Idaho, Wyoming, Montana, Washington and Oregon. It's a really interesting product. ZynNT can be stored at room temperature and has a one year shelf life from the date it’s manufactured. It also has the first and only child resistant lid, which can be difficult to open at first, even for an adult.  Also, these cans do not have a catch lid.  But, you may be asking yourself, "What is Zyn NT"?

ZynNT has non-woven pouches which contain flavor, non-tobacco filler, nicotine salts and pH balancers which help enhance the nicotine delivery. Basically the nicotine is soaked out of the tobacco leaves using high pH water then it is filtered to remove any elements of tobacco. What you have left is pure nicotine salt.  You'll notice it looks much like table salt. If you're interested in a more detailed explanation of the science behind ZynNT, my friend Larry at SnusCENTRAL.org wrote a great article on that.  There are 15 portions in a can with each portion weighing 0.4 grams.  The portions are about the same length and width as a regular snus portion, but are much, much slimmer.  They are virtually flat.  The cans are also the same diameter as a regular snus can, but are also a little bit slimmer.

The flavor description for Zyn NT Spearmint says, "A smoother, slightly sweeter mint."  The portions are interesting to touch.  I've had purified portions in the past, but these didn't feel quite as dry.  When you open the can, the aroma that comes through is a very faint, mild spearmint smell.  The aroma is also not overly sweet, which I find to be nice.  The portions feel softer to the lip than I expected.  They're thinner than a regular snus pouch, but don't feel as small as a mini portion.  The flavor takes a little while to develop; at first you don't notice much taste at all.  At around the 5 to 10 minute mark you'll start to notice the taste of spearmint.  It comes on in a very, very mild way.  Also, like the aroma, it isn't too overbearingly sweet, which I appreciate.  The flavor does mature to become more present, but it doesn't get to be too bold.  It's a surprisingly enjoyable taste.  I find the flavor lasts up to about the 45 minutes to 1 hour mark.  When it comes to the nicotine, there are two strengths: 3mg and 6mg.  With the 6mg, I do experience satisfaction.  I use mostly 8mg/g snus, and with the 6mg level I did notice nicotine and felt the same level of satisfaction I feel with my usual snus.  With the 3mg level, I didn't notice much nicotine, so I imagine this is going to be for someone who doesn't need as much nicotine.  If you've used mini portion snus before, it feels to deliver about the same amount of nicotine.
